| Comments: |
Nice and sunny out today though the winds were up and temps were a bit chilly. Great views from the top though Washington in the clouds and blowing snow making other views a bit hazy. Met 5 others out on the trail today. A bit of mud right at the start before the logs across the water. Snow began at the switchbacks - trace amount down low to about 1/4 inch up high. Some water and in places some ice on the ledges on davis and the spur - enough in places so you need to keep your eyes open and be careful with footing but not enough to warrant traction. |
